Ядро и систему собирал сам.
Информация о системе.
uname -a
lsusb
Код: Выделить всё
Linux dimonchik230 4.19.66-gentoo #5 SMP Wed Aug 21 19:41:48 EEST 2019 x86_64 AMD A8-7600 Radeon R7, 10 Compute Cores 4C+6G AuthenticAMD GNU/Linux
Код: Выделить всё
Bus 009 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
Bus 008 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 005 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 004 Device 002: ID 0a12:0001 Cambridge Silicon Radio, Ltd Bluetooth Dongle (HCI mode)
Bus 004 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 001 Device 003: ID 148f:761a Ralink Technology, Corp. MT7610U ("Archer T2U" 2.4G+5G WLAN Adapter
Bus 001 Device 002: ID 046d:09a4 Logitech, Inc. QuickCam E 3500
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 003 Device 002: ID 24ae:2010
Bus 003 Device 001: ID 1d6b:0001 Linux Foundation 1.1 root hub
Bus 007 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
Bus 006 Device 002: ID 055f:021f Mustek Systems, Inc. SNAPSCAN e22
Bus 006 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Драйвера адаптера mt76 и mt76x0. mt76x0 для работы подгружает микропрограмму /lib/firmware/mediatek/mt7610u.bin, что видно из modinfo mt76x0
modinfo mt76x0
Код: Выделить всё
filename: /lib/modules/4.19.66-gentoo/kernel/drivers/net/wireless/mediatek/mt76/mt76x0/mt76x0.ko
license: GPL
firmware: mediatek/mt7610u.bin
alias: usb:v0E8Dp7650d*dc*dsc*dp*icFFisc02ipFFin*
alias: usb:v0E8Dp7630d*dc*dsc*dp*icFFisc02ipFFin*
alias: usb:v2357p0105d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v0DF6p0079d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v7392pC711d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v20F4p806Bd*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v293Cp5702d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v057Cp8502d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v04BBp0951d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v07B8p7610d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v0586p3425d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v2001p3D02d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v2019pAB31d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v0DF6p0075d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v0B05p17DBd*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v0B05p17D1d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v148Fp760Ad*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v148Fp761Ad*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v7392pB711d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v7392pA711d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v0E8Dp7610d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v13B1p003Ed*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v148Fp7610d*dc*dsc*dp*ic*isc*ip*in*
depends: mac80211,mt76,cfg80211
retpoline: Y
intree: Y
name: mt76x0
vermagic: 4.19.66-gentoo SMP mod_unload
Код: Выделить всё
[ 6.932533] platform regulatory.0: Direct firmware load for regulatory.db failed with error -2
[ 6.932534] cfg80211: failed to load regulatory.db
Информация из Ubuntu
lsmod
modinfo mt76x0u
Единственное отличие в ней используются еще микропрограмма mediatek/mt7610e.bin и такие модули mt76x02-lib,mt76-usb,mt76,mt76x0-common,mt76x02-usb в Gentoo они отвечают за другие устройства и при сборке вроде ни на что не влияют.
Код: Выделить всё
Module Size Used by
ccm 20480 3
rfcomm 77824 4
btrfs 1167360 0
zstd_compress 163840 1 btrfs
libcrc32c 16384 1 btrfs
xor 24576 1 btrfs
arc4 16384 2
raid6_pq 114688 1 btrfs
cmac 16384 1
bnep 24576 2
edac_mce_amd 28672 0
kvm_amd 90112 0
mt76x0u 20480 0
ccp 86016 1 kvm_amd
mt76x0_common 45056 1 mt76x0u
saa7134_alsa 24576 1
snd_hda_codec_hdmi 53248 1
mt76x02_usb 16384 1 mt76x0u
mt76_usb 32768 2 mt76x02_usb,mt76x0u
mt76x02_lib 61440 3 mt76x02_usb,mt76x0_common,mt76x0u
kvm 626688 1 kvm_amd
btusb 49152 0
mt76 49152 5 mt76_usb,mt76x02_lib,mt76x02_usb,mt76x0_common,mt76x0u
mac80211 815104 5 mt76,mt76_usb,mt76x02_lib,mt76x0_common,mt76x0u
btrtl 20480 1 btusb
btbcm 16384 1 btusb
saa7134 176128 1 saa7134_alsa
btintel 24576 1 btusb
irqbypass 16384 1 kvm
bluetooth 557056 33 btrtl,btintel,btbcm,bnep,btusb,rfcomm
tveeprom 28672 1 saa7134
rc_core 49152 1 saa7134
crct10dif_pclmul 16384 1
crc32_pclmul 16384 0
uvcvideo 94208 0
ghash_clmulni_intel 16384 0
v4l2_common 16384 1 saa7134
videobuf2_dma_sg 16384 1 saa7134
videobuf2_vmalloc 20480 1 uvcvideo
videobuf2_memops 20480 2 videobuf2_vmalloc,videobuf2_dma_sg
videobuf2_v4l2 24576 2 saa7134,uvcvideo
snd_hda_codec_realtek 114688 1
aesni_intel 372736 4
videobuf2_common 45056 3 saa7134,videobuf2_v4l2,uvcvideo
snd_usb_audio 233472 1
snd_hda_codec_generic 77824 1 snd_hda_codec_realtek
videodev 200704 5 v4l2_common,saa7134,videobuf2_v4l2,uvcvideo,videobuf2_common
cfg80211 675840 3 mt76x02_lib,mac80211,mt76x02_usb
ledtrig_audio 16384 2 snd_hda_codec_generic,snd_hda_codec_realtek
snd_hda_intel 40960 5
snd_hda_codec 131072 4 snd_hda_codec_generic,snd_hda_codec_hdmi,snd_hda_intel,snd_hda_codec_realtek
ecdh_generic 28672 2 bluetooth
snd_usbmidi_lib 36864 1 snd_usb_audio
snd_hda_core 86016 5 snd_hda_codec_generic,snd_hda_codec_hdmi,snd_hda_intel,snd_hda_codec,snd_hda_codec_realtek
aes_x86_64 20480 1 aesni_intel
snd_hwdep 20480 2 snd_usb_audio,snd_hda_codec
joydev 28672 0
input_leds 16384 0
snd_pcm 102400 6 snd_hda_codec_hdmi,snd_hda_intel,snd_usb_audio,snd_hda_codec,saa7134_alsa,snd_hda_core
crypto_simd 16384 1 aesni_intel
media 53248 5 videodev,saa7134,videobuf2_v4l2,uvcvideo,videobuf2_common
cryptd 24576 3 crypto_simd,ghash_clmulni_intel,aesni_intel
snd_seq_midi 20480 0
snd_seq_midi_event 16384 1 snd_seq_midi
glue_helper 16384 1 aesni_intel
snd_rawmidi 36864 2 snd_seq_midi,snd_usbmidi_lib
fam15h_power 16384 0
snd_seq 69632 2 snd_seq_midi,snd_seq_midi_event
k10temp 16384 0
snd_seq_device 16384 3 snd_seq,snd_seq_midi,snd_rawmidi
snd_timer 36864 2 snd_seq,snd_pcm
snd 86016 28 snd_hda_codec_generic,snd_seq,snd_seq_device,snd_hda_codec_hdmi,snd_hwdep,snd_hda_intel,snd_usb_audio,snd_usbmidi_lib,snd_hda_codec,snd_hda_codec_realtek,snd_timer,saa7134_alsa,snd_pcm,snd_rawmidi
soundcore 16384 1 snd
mac_hid 16384 0
sch_fq_codel 20480 2
parport_pc 36864 1
ppdev 24576 0
lp 20480 0
parport 53248 3 parport_pc,lp,ppdev
ip_tables 32768 0
x_tables 40960 1 ip_tables
autofs4 45056 2
overlay 110592 1
nls_iso8859_1 16384 1
dm_mirror 24576 0
dm_region_hash 20480 1 dm_mirror
dm_log 20480 2 dm_region_hash,dm_mirror
hid_generic 16384 0
usbhid 53248 0
hid 126976 2 usbhid,hid_generic
uas 24576 0
usb_storage 69632 2 uas
nouveau 1863680 9
mxm_wmi 16384 1 nouveau
wmi 28672 2 mxm_wmi,nouveau
i2c_algo_bit 16384 1 nouveau
ttm 102400 1 nouveau
drm_kms_helper 180224 1 nouveau
syscopyarea 16384 1 drm_kms_helper
sysfillrect 16384 1 drm_kms_helper
sysimgblt 16384 1 drm_kms_helper
fb_sys_fops 16384 1 drm_kms_helper
i2c_piix4 28672 0
drm 479232 6 drm_kms_helper,ttm,nouveau
r8169 81920 0
ahci 40960 1
realtek 20480 0
libahci 32768 1 ahci
video 49152 1 nouveau
Код: Выделить всё
filename: /lib/modules/5.0.0-23-generic/kernel/drivers/net/wireless/mediatek/mt76/mt76x0/mt76x0u.ko
license: GPL
firmware: mediatek/mt7610u.bin
firmware: mediatek/mt7610e.bin
srcversion: F1D97DC04410D6E86E238AD
alias: usb:v0E8Dp7650d*dc*dsc*dp*icFFisc02ipFFin*
alias: usb:v0E8Dp7630d*dc*dsc*dp*icFFisc02ipFFin*
alias: usb:v2357p0105d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v0DF6p0079d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v7392pC711d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v20F4p806Bd*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v293Cp5702d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v057Cp8502d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v04BBp0951d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v07B8p7610d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v0586p3425d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v2001p3D02d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v2019pAB31d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v0DF6p0075d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v0B05p17DBd*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v0B05p17D1d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v148Fp760Ad*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v148Fp761Ad*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v7392pB711d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v7392pA711d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v0E8Dp7610d*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v13B1p003Ed*dc*dsc*dp*ic*isc*ip*in*
alias: usb:v148Fp7610d*dc*dsc*dp*ic*isc*ip*in*
depends: mt76x02-lib,mt76-usb,mt76,mac80211,mt76x0-common,mt76x02-usb
retpoline: Y
intree: Y
name: mt76x0u
vermagic: 5.0.0-23-generic SMP mod_unload
signat: PKCS#7
signer:
sig_key:
sig_hashalgo: md4